Groundwater discharge Composite Drainage Net

Composite Drainage Net is a new type of drainage geosynthetic product, it is made from three-dimension drainage net bonding to needle punched non woven geotextile by one or two sides. Three dimensional composites drainage network consists of a tri-dimension thick vertical rib, and a inclined rip on the top and bottom.

    Composite drainage network is a multi-layer structured geosynthetic material composed of high-strength non-woven fabric and drainage core layer. It has functions such as drainage, filtration, corrosion prevention, and reinforcement, and its main uses include

    Video Showcase

    Groundwater discharge: Composite drainage networks can be used as drainage systems in areas with high groundwater levels, effectively draining groundwater, lowering groundwater levels, preventing soil liquefaction and foundation settlement.

    Surface drainage: Composite drainage networks can be used as drainage systems on the ground to quickly remove rainwater and post rain accumulated water, reducing the occurrence of water disasters and floods.

    Anti seepage and anti-corrosion: Composite drainage networks can prevent the loss of soil particles, protect soil stability, and prevent fine particles from infiltrating the drainage system, avoiding clogging of drainage holes.

    Strengthening soil: Composite drainage networks can closely integrate with soil, enhance the tensile and shear strength of soil, improve the stability and bearing capacity of soil, and be used for slope and slope reinforcement to slow down soil erosion and landslide occurrence.

    Plant growth: Composite drainage networks can serve as the bottom layer of vegetation coverage systems, providing good drainage and ventilation conditions, promoting plant growth and root development, and are used for greening, landscape, and ecological engineering.
